A quick reminder on pre-orders too. If there is a forthcoming KATO item you know you want, pre-ordering is still the best way to secure it. We do not ask for payment up front on pre-orders, so there is no immediate cost to reserving something. You have the option of adding card details for easy of payment when they arrive, but it's your choice whether or not to do this.

All we ask is that pre-orders are made in good faith. We understand that circumstances change, but we do get mildly grumpy if people wait until the stock arrives and then cancel, as by that point we have ordered it specially and committed the cash and shelf space.
